Police in Kumasi have arrested a 48-year-old businessman, Francis Arthur, in connection with the death of his girlfriend, Sally Benson, following a reported domestic dispute.

According to reports, the incident occurred on April 14, 2026, at the suspect’s residence at Ayigya-Maxima.

Sally Benson, a well-known beautician and owner of Sally’s Cosmetics Studio and African’s Special Pub in Asokwa, had reportedly gone to Arthur’s house with a female friend after hearing that another woman had visited him.

Sources indicate that tensions escalated when Arthur returned home, leading to a heated argument between the couple.

During the confrontation, Arthur is alleged to have physically assaulted Benson until she collapsed. In what appears to have been an attempt to save her, he reportedly transported her in her own vehicle to the KNUST Hospital.

However, medical personnel at the facility pronounced her dead on arrival.

The suspect was subsequently arrested and arraigned before the Asokore Mampong District Court, where he was remanded into police custody. He is expected to reappear in court on May 8, 2026, as investigations continue.

The deceased’s father, Apostle Gabriel Oppong, has called for justice, urging authorities to ensure that due process is followed.
